Gary Meininger
Position: Coach - Other
Other Position: Volunteer Assistant Coach

Joining the Duck coaching staff for his first season in 2012, Gary Meininger brings an impressive and wide array of coaching expertise in both volleyball and a host of prep sports.

A 34-year member of the Oaklea Middle School staff, he has served as the Junction City High School volleyball head coach the past 10 years. In that span, his squad have successfully advanced to the state playoffs eight seasons and the OSAA state tournament four years.

In 2006, his team won the Sky-Em league, and he was honored as the league coach of the year.

He has also worked six years as a club volleyball coach for the Oregon Volleyball Club (formally known as Storm-n-West VC), and also at Oregon camps in the same span.

In his prep coaching career year, he has also coached middle school football, wrestling, basketball, and track and field, and served as the middle school athletic director. His dedication to prep sports also includes 20 years as an OSAA wrestling official.

A former collegiate wrestler for Pacific Lutheran University (1972-76), he received a degree in physical education from the institution near Tacoma, Wash.

The Oak Harbor, Wash., native and his wife Sherri have three daughters Renee (30), Kelsey (21), and Kiersten (17), and Sherri is University of Oregon graduate (1984).

Off the court, his hobbies include racquetball, golf and fly-fishing.
